Summary
Defines computer fraud in the third degree and designates it as a class C felony. Amends section 708-891 and 708-891.5, Hawaii Revised Statutes, to include computer fraud that occurs not only when accessing a computer, but also when accessing a computer system or computer network; makes computer fraud in the first degree a class A felony, and makes computer fraud in the second degree a class B felony.
